I want to deliver my compound to animals. What is the best solvent to use?
When choosing a delivery vehicle, consider the properties of the compound (polarity, solubility, stability), the route of administration, the final intended dose, animal mass, and possible confounding effects of the solvent. While water and saline are convenient for gavage and injection, they are not suitable for hydrophobic compounds. Ethanol and DMSO can be used to make stock solutions but should be present at less than 0.1% in most applications.* Even then, they may have unwanted effects in certain systems. Vehicles such as vegetable oil or polymer preparations of cyclodextrin (CD), carboxymethyl cellulose (CMC), or polyethylene glycol (PEG) can be effective vehicles for extremely hydrophobic compounds. With any vehicle, toxicity should be assessed with a vehicle control before testing the compound in large numbers of animals. Note: All animal experiments should be authorized by your Institutional Animal Care and Use Committee and/or veterinary staff.
